Corrosion-resistant PHC pipe pile end plate
By installing sealing gaskets, moving rings, limiting springs, and corrosion-resistant coatings on the pipe pile end plates, the problems of deformation, water leakage, and air leakage of the pipe pile end plates are solved, achieving a high-strength and long-life sealing effect.

AI Technical Summary
Existing pipe pile end plates are prone to deformation and denting during long-term use, leading to water and air leaks, and lack of effective sealing structures, which affects their service life.
A corrosion-resistant PHC pipe pile end plate was designed, which uses sealing gaskets, moving rings, limiting springs, protective gaskets and corrosion-resistant coatings. The sealing performance and deformation resistance of the connection are enhanced through a multi-layer sealing structure and reinforcing plates.
It improves the sealing and deformation resistance of the pipe pile end plate, reduces the possibility of water and air leakage, and extends the service life.

TECHNICAL FIELD
[0001] The utility model relates to a pipe pile end plate technical field, concretely to a kind of corrosion-resistant PHC pipe pile end plate. BACKGROUND
[0002] Pipe pile, i.e. prestressed high-strength concrete pipe pile, is a kind of efficient prefabricated component widely used in modern construction engineering and foundation engineering, which has been widely used in the field of construction with its high strength, high durability and construction convenience. The pipe pile needs to be used with the end plate to facilitate the connection and sealing between the pipe piles.
[0003] The prior art with the authorization publication number CN218409011U discloses a pipe pile end plate structure, which comprises an end plate body, a trumpet ring opening is arranged on the right side of the end plate body, an annular skirt is fixedly connected to the surface of the end plate body, a reinforcing layer is fixedly connected to the inside of the end plate body, a core layer is fixedly connected to the inside of the reinforcing layer, and an anti-deformation layer is fixedly connected to the right side of the core layer. The utility model solves the problem that most pipe pile end plates on the market do not have high strength, which leads to deformation and indentation of the pipe pile end plate during long-term use, making the pipe pile end plate unable to be used normally, and causing water leakage and air leakage, which affects the normal use of the pipe pile end plate. The effect of high strength and long service life is achieved. The pipe pile end plate can prevent water leakage and air leakage due to deformation during use by improving the strength of the end plate. However, since the surface is not provided with a sealing structure, water leakage and air leakage still occur when two end plates are connected. Therefore, we propose a corrosion-resistant PHC pipe pile end plate to solve the above problems. SUMMARY

[0008] The utility model provides a kind of corrosion-resistant PHC pipe pile end plate, including end plate one and end plate two, the top of the end plate one and the bottom of end plate two are attached, the top of the end plate one and the bottom of end plate two are fixed with sealing washer, two sealing washers are closely attached, the top of the end plate one is equipped with annular sink, the inside of the annular sink is provided with moving ring, limit spring is fixed in annular array between the moving ring and annular sink, the top of the moving ring is fixed with protective washer, the bottom of the end plate two is equipped with sealing groove compatible with moving ring, the moving ring is sealed and connected in the inside of sealing groove, the top of the end plate one and end plate two is equipped with mounting hole in annular array.
[0009] Further, the surface of the end plate one and end plate two is fixed with trapezoidal reinforcing plate in annular array, arc-shaped support plate is fixed between adjacent two trapezoidal reinforcing plates, the top of the arc-shaped support plate is equipped with give-way hole compatible with mounting hole.
[0010] Further, the surface of the end plate one is fixed with guide block in annular array, the surface of the end plate two is fixed with plug compatible with guide block in annular array, the plug is respectively inserted in the inside of corresponding guide block.
[0011] Further, the top of the end plate one and the bottom of end plate two are fixed with rubber washer, two rubber washers are closely attached.
[0012] Further, the surface of the end plate one and end plate two is provided with corrosion-resistant coating, and the corrosion-resistant coating is a hot-dip galvanized coating.
[0013] Further, the limit spring is made of stainless steel.
[0014] (Three) beneficial effects
[0015] Compared with the prior art, the utility model provides a kind of corrosion-resistant PHC pipe pile end plate, with the following beneficial effects:
[0016] The utility model discloses a kind of corrosion-resistant PHC pipe pile end plate, with the following beneficial effects: by being provided with end plate one, end plate two, sealing washer, annular sink, moving ring, limit spring, protective washer and sealing groove, in the process of using this corrosion-resistant PHC pipe pile end plate, after connecting and fixing end plate one and end plate two, the sealing washer set between the two can play the effect of primary sealing protection, and after the connection of the two, the moving ring pressed on end plate one is tightly inserted in the inside of the sealing groove of end plate two, at this time, under the effect of protective washer, the effect of secondary sealing between the two can be played, and then when end plate one and end plate two are connected, the possibility of water leakage and air leakage can be reduced, by being provided with trapezoidal reinforcing plate and arc-shaped support plate, so that the anti-deformation performance of end plate one and end plate two as a whole can be enhanced. [0023] Embodiment
[0024] As Figure 1 , Figure 2 , Figure 3 and Figure 4As shown, one embodiment of the utility model discloses a kind of corrosion-resistant PHC pipe pile end plate, including end plate one 1 and end plate two 2, the top of end plate one 1 and the bottom of end plate two 2 are all fixed with rubber gasket 14, two rubber gaskets 14 are closely adhered, it is sealed to play the effect of enhancement again when end plate one 1 and end plate two 2 are connected and fixed, end plate one 1 top and the bottom of end plate two 2 adhere, the top of end plate one 1 and the bottom of end plate two 2 are all fixed with sealing washer 3, two sealing washers 3 are closely adhered, the top of end plate one 1 is provided with annular sink 4, annular sink 4 is provided with moving ring 5 inside, limit spring 6 is fixed between moving ring 5 and annular sink 4 in annular array, limit spring 6 is made of stainless steel, stainless steel spring usually has higher strength and durability, can withstand greater pressure and frequent use, its service life is longer, the top of moving ring 5 is fixed with protective washer 7, the bottom of end plate two 2 is provided with sealing groove 8 compatible with moving ring 5, moving ring 5 is sealed and clamped in the inside of sealing groove 8, the top of end plate one 1 and end plate two 2 is all provided with mounting hole 9 in annular array, when using this corrosion-resistant PHC pipe pile end plate, after end plate one 1 and end plate two 2 are connected, two sealing washers 3 arranged between them will be closely adhered, at this time, it can be sealed between them once protective effect, and when they are connected, at this time, end plate two 2 will extrude moving ring 5 and move down, moving ring 5 will extrude limit spring 6 after moving down, at this time, the top of moving ring 5 will be tightly clamped in the inside of sealing groove 8, then under the cooperation of protective washer 7, it can be sealed and protected again for end plate one 1 and end plate two 2 after connection.
[0025] As Figure 1 Shown, in some embodiments, the surface of end plate one 1 and end plate two 2 is all fixed with trapezoidal reinforcing plate 10 in annular array, adjacent two trapezoidal reinforcing plates 10 are fixed with arc-shaped support plate 11, the top of arc-shaped support plate 11 is provided with relief hole 16 compatible with mounting hole 9, trapezoidal reinforcing plate 10 is fixed on the surface of end plate one 1 and end plate two 2 in annular array, so that end plate one 1 and end plate two 2 will not easily deform after being connected.
[0026] As Figure 1 , Figure 3 And Figure 4 Shown, in some embodiments, the surface of end plate one 1 is fixed with guide block 12 in annular array, the surface of end plate two 2 is fixed with plug 13 compatible with guide block 12 in annular array, plug 13 is respectively inserted in the inside of corresponding guide block 12, when end plate one 1 and end plate two 2 are connected and fixed, it can play the role of guiding positioning under the cooperation of two, so that the mounting hole 9 of end plate one 1 and end plate two 2 can be accurately aligned.
[0027] As Figure 2As shown, in some embodiments, the surface of the end plate one 1 and the end plate two 2 are provided with a corrosion-resistant coating 15, which is a hot-dip galvanizing coating, by immersing the end plate in molten zinc to form a zinc layer on the surface, which can isolate oxygen, water and other corrosive media, and has a long protection time.
